Abstract
Siliceous cubic Y (FAU) and hexagonal Y (EMT) materials are synthesise d and characterised. The effect of varying the amount of template (cro wn ethers) and of adding fluoride ions to the synthesis gel on the mor phology and crystal size of product crystals is discussed. Smaller, mo re uniform, crystals were obtained when fluoride ions were added to th e synthesis mixtures.
